In the medical field, 'Keep In View' (KIV) is a term often used to denote the importance of monitoring a patient's condition or a specific parameter over time. It underscores the necessity for continuous observation to detect any changes that may require intervention. This approach is pivotal in managing chronic conditions, post-operative care, and during the administration of certain medications where side effects are a concern.
Moreover, 'Keep In View' extends beyond patient monitoring to include the tracking of medical equipment and supplies, ensuring they are in optimal condition and readily available when needed. This dual application highlights the term's versatility in healthcare settings, emphasizing the critical role of vigilance in maintaining high standards of patient care and operational efficiency.
